--- /Metaphone.java	2023-07-05 03:05:47.350038965 +0200
+++ /Codec-1/src/java/org/apache/commons/codec/language/Metaphone.java	2023-07-05 03:05:47.350038965 +0200
@@ -187,7 +187,7 @@
                     }
                     break ;
                 case 'D' :
-                    if (!isLastChar(wdsz, n + 1) && 
+if  ( isLastChar ( wdsz, n )  )  {     break; }
                         isNextChar(local, n, 'G') && 
                         (FRONTV.indexOf(local.charAt(n + 2)) >= 0)) { // DGE DGI DGY -> J 
                         code.append('J'); n += 2 ;
